Teams自动化消息分发设置指南

Teams Microsoft Teams作品 4

目录导读

  • 自动化消息分发的基本概念
  • Teams内置自动化工具详解
  • Power Automate集成配置步骤
  • 高级自动化方案与技巧
  • 常见问题解答(FAQ)
  • 最佳实践与注意事项

自动化消息分发的基本概念

Microsoft Teams中的自动化消息分发是指通过预设规则和工具,自动向特定频道、团队成员或群组发送消息的技术,这项功能可以显著提高团队协作效率,减少重复性手动操作,确保重要信息及时传达。

Teams自动化消息分发设置指南-第1张图片-Microsoft Teams - Microsoft Teams下载【官方网站】

自动化消息分发主要应用于以下场景:

  • 每日/每周报告自动推送
  • 系统警报和监控通知
  • 新成员加入欢迎消息
  • 项目里程碑更新提醒
  • 跨平台信息同步

Teams内置自动化工具详解

Teams频道连接器

Teams频道连接器是内置的自动化工具,允许外部服务直接向Teams频道发送消息,设置方法如下:

  1. 在目标频道点击“•••”更多选项
  2. 选择“连接器”
  3. 从列表中选择需要的服务(如GitHub、Trello、Azure DevOps等)
  4. 按照提示完成配置和认证

预定消息功能

Teams近期推出了预定消息功能,虽然需要手动设置发送时间,但可以实现半自动化消息分发:

  • 在消息输入框右侧找到“•••”扩展选项
  • 选择“预定消息”
  • 设置发送日期和时间
  • 选择目标接收者或频道

消息扩展和机器人

通过Teams应用商店安装消息扩展和机器人,可以实现更复杂的自动化流程,常用的自动化机器人包括:

  • Power Virtual Agents:创建对话式AI机器人
  • Azure Bot Service:构建自定义业务逻辑机器人
  • 第三方集成机器人:如Zapier、Make等集成平台的机器人

Power Automate集成配置步骤

Microsoft Power Automate是Teams自动化消息分发的核心工具,以下是详细配置流程:

步骤1:创建自动化流程

  1. 访问Power Automate门户(flow.microsoft.com)
  2. 点击“创建”>“自动化云端流”
  3. 为流程命名,选择触发条件

步骤2:设置触发条件

常用触发条件包括:

  • 定期计划:按固定时间间隔触发
  • 新电子邮件到达时:将Outlook邮件转发到Teams
  • 当项目创建时:从SharePoint、Planner等应用触发
  • HTTP请求:通过API调用触发

步骤3:配置Teams操作

  1. 添加新操作,搜索“Teams”
  2. 选择“在聊天或频道中发布消息”
  3. 配置以下参数:
    • 团队ID:目标团队
    • 频道ID:目标频道
    • 支持动态内容和格式
    • 附件:可添加文件或图片

步骤4:添加条件逻辑

使用“条件”控件创建分支逻辑:类型分发到不同频道

  • 按时间条件发送差异化消息
  • 基于用户角色定向发送消息

步骤5:测试和部署

  1. 点击“测试”按钮验证流程
  2. 检查Teams中是否收到测试消息
  3. 调整参数优化流程
  4. 启用流程并监控运行状态

高级自动化方案与技巧

多频道同步分发

通过Power Automate的“应用操作”功能,可以同时向多个频道发送相同消息:

  • 使用“应用到每个”循环控件
  • 创建频道ID数组变量
  • 配置并行执行提高效率

格式化

利用自适应卡片和Markdown增强消息效果:

# 每日报告 - {formatDateTime(utcNow(),'yyyy-MM-dd')}
**完成项目**:{length(triggerOutputs()?['body/items'])}个
**待处理**:{x}项
[查看详情](https://yourlink.com)

条件性提醒系统

创建智能提醒系统:

  • 仅在工作时间发送非紧急通知
  • 紧急警报使用@提及特定成员
  • 根据消息优先级添加不同视觉标记

跨平台集成

将Teams与其他办公系统集成:

  • SharePoint列表更新时自动通知
  • Excel数据变化时发送摘要
  • CRM系统事件触发Teams提醒

常见问题解答(FAQ)

Q1:Teams自动化消息分发需要额外许可吗? A:基础功能如连接器和预定消息不需要额外许可,但Power Automate高级功能可能需要Microsoft 365相应许可,具体取决于使用场景和连接器类型。

Q2:可以自动向特定成员发送私聊消息吗? A:可以,通过Power Automate的“向用户发送消息”操作,可以自动向特定成员发送私聊消息,需要确保流程所有者与被发送者在同一组织。

Q3:如何确保自动化消息不会造成信息过载? A:建议:1) 设置消息优先级系统;2) 创建静默时段规则;3) 允许用户选择订阅类型;4) 定期审查和优化发送频率。

Q4:自动化消息支持附件吗? A:是的,通过Power Automate,可以附加来自OneDrive、SharePoint或直接上传的文件,大小限制取决于文件来源,通常为100MB以内。

Q5:能否根据Teams成员的响应触发后续操作? A:可以,使用自适应卡片或消息扩展,可以捕获用户交互(如按钮点击、选择项),并基于此触发后续自动化流程。

Q6:如何监控自动化消息的送达情况? A:在Power Automate中查看流程运行历史,可以了解每次执行的详细状态,对于重要消息,建议添加确认机制或阅读回执。

最佳实践与注意事项

最佳实践

  1. 分阶段实施:先在小范围测试,再逐步扩大自动化范围
  2. 明确目的:每个自动化流程应有清晰的业务目标
  3. 用户培训:确保团队成员了解如何与自动化消息交互
  4. 定期优化:每季度审查自动化流程的有效性和必要性
  5. 备份方案:重要通知应有备用发送渠道

安全注意事项

  • 最小权限原则:仅授予自动化流程必要的访问权限
  • 敏感信息处理:避免在自动化消息中包含密码、密钥等敏感数据
  • 审核日志:保留自动化操作日志以备审计
  • 用户同意:涉及个人数据时确保符合隐私政策

性能优化建议

  1. 批量处理:将多个小消息合并为定期摘要
  2. 非高峰发送:安排在非工作时间发送非紧急消息
  3. 错误处理:配置重试机制和失败通知
  4. 资源监控:关注API调用次数,避免超过限制

SEO优化提示

  • 在相关文档中使用“Teams自动化”、“消息分发”、“Power Automate配置”等关键词
  • 创建结构化数据,方便搜索引擎理解内容层次定期更新,反映Teams最新功能变化
  • 建立内部链接网络,连接相关帮助文档

通过合理设置Teams自动化消息分发,组织可以显著提升沟通效率,确保信息及时准确传达,随着Teams功能的不断更新,自动化能力也将持续增强,建议定期关注Microsoft官方更新日志,及时优化现有自动化流程。

无论是小型团队的基础提醒,还是企业级的复杂通知系统,Teams提供的自动化工具都能提供灵活可靠的解决方案,关键在于根据实际需求选择合适的工具组合,并遵循最佳实践确保系统稳定运行。

标签: Teams设置指南

抱歉,评论功能暂时关闭!